Abstract
It is proposed in connection with a method for the interferometric radar measurement in conjunction with a helicopter operating in accordance with the ROSAR principle (Heli-Radar) that two coherent receiving antennas with receiving channels are associated with a transmitter of the ROSAR-system mounted on the revolving rotary cross; and that the difference (ΔR) between the two distances (R+ΔR, R) from the measured impact point P are calculated, in the manner known per se, based on the wavelength λ of the emitted radar signal and the measured phase difference of the receiving echo of the two coherent receive channels.
